Bendel Insurance Set For Season Resumption As Supporters Club Reaffirms Loyalty Ahead Of 2025/26 NPFL Campaign

As Bendel Insurance Football Club prepares to resume activities for the 2025/26 Nigeria Premier Football League (NPFL) season, the club’s Supporters’ Club has renewed its pledge of unwavering support, vowing to stand by the team “come rain or sun.”

The resumption date, officially set for Sunday, June 22, 2025, marks the beginning of pre-season training for the Benin-based side, following a one-month break after the 2024/25 season ended on May 25.

In a significant show of unity, the Supporters’ Club—led by Chief Osadolor Ogiefa—held a joint meeting with the club’s technical crew, including Head Coach Greg Ikhenoba, in Benin City.

During the meeting, Chief Ogiefa lauded the team’s remarkable turnaround last season, rising from the relegation zone to a top-five finish, which reignited hopes of continental competition qualification.

“We are proud of our darling club and commend Coach Greg Ikhenoba and his team for their resilience,” said Chief Ogiefa. “With the right players and teamwork, we are confident of achieving a podium finish next season.”

He also emphasized the importance of recruiting disciplined and dedicated players, asserting that with the commitment from the Edo State Government, management, and supporters, the onus is now on the players to deliver success.

In response, Coach Ikhenoba expressed gratitude for the support shown by fans during difficult times last season, describing the Bendel Insurance Supporters Club as “the best in the country.”

“The trust and backing from our supporters gave us the strength to push through,” Ikhenoba said. “We’ll work even harder to bring silverware to Edo State next season.”

According to a circular from club secretary Charles Ihimekpen, players and officials are to report for duty on Sunday, June 22, with the first training session scheduled for 8:00 a.m. on Monday, June 23.

Meanwhile, the NPFL board has confirmed that the 2025/26 league season will officially kick off on August 22, 2025, setting the stage for what promises to be a fiercely competitive campaign.
